Acer Liquid E1 Announced

Acer is not the first name that comes to the mind where smartphones and tablets are concerned, but they are involved in both markets, just in case you were wondering. Having said that, there is a new mid-range Android-powered smartphone that you might want to consider if you are on the lookout for one that fits nicely down the middle, where it is known as the Acer Liquid E1. Just in case it looks familiar, that is because this is more or less the Acer CloudMobile S500, albeit with lesser specifications.

Underneath the hood, you will find a 1GHz dual-core processor accompanied by 1GB RAM, carrying 4GB of internal memory, with Android 4.1.1 Jelly Bean running right out of box. There is a 4.5-inch display at qHD resolution alongside a 5-megapixel auto-focus camera at the back with LED flash, and a front-facing VGA camera. Other features include an FM receiver and a microSD memory card slot for expansion purposes, but it is rather weird that Acer has yet to release information on pricing and availability.
